Understanding how Florida\u2019s points system works and what kinds of infractions add points to your record can help you make more informed decisions. In Florida, a single speeding ticket or running a red light isn\u2019t just a ticket \u2014 it\u2019s potentially a mark on your record that could cost you big time in the long run.<\/p><h3>How Does Florida&#8217;s Points System Work?<\/h3><p>The points system in Florida assigns a specific number of points to various traffic infractions, from speeding to reckless driving. Accumulating points within a certain timeframe can lead to consequences that go beyond fines, including license suspensions. Here\u2019s a breakdown of some of the most common offenses and how many points they can add to your license:<\/p><ul><li><strong>Speeding (less than 15 mph over the limit)<\/strong>: 3 points<\/li><li><strong>Speeding (15 mph or more over the limit)<\/strong>: 4 points<\/li><li><strong>Reckless driving<\/strong>: 4 points<\/li><li><strong>Passing a stopped school bus<\/strong>: 4 points<\/li><li><strong>Leaving the scene of a minor accident<\/strong>: 6 points<\/li><\/ul><p>\u00a0<\/p><p>For every point, the penalties become harsher as you approach thresholds for license suspension. If you accumulate <strong>12 points within 12 months<\/strong>, your license can be suspended for 30 days. Accumulating <strong>18 points within 18 months<\/strong> results in a three-month suspension, and <strong>24 points within 36 months<\/strong> brings a one-year suspension. While each company uses its own formula for rate adjustments, drivers with points on their record typically pay <strong>between 20% to 50% more<\/strong> than drivers with clean records. This spike can last for years, even if you\u2019ve only had a single infraction. According to one source the increase can be <a href=\"https:\/\/www.bankrate.com\/insurance\/car\/speeding-ticket-florida\/#how-much-is-a-speeding-ticket-in-florida\">upwards of 15%<\/a> for a single ticket. For many, one or two minor incidents might add up to thousands of dollars in insurance costs over a few years.<\/p><p>Additionally, the more severe the infraction, the bigger the impact. A few points for a minor speeding ticket could bump up your rate by $100 or so, but a serious infraction \u2014 like reckless driving or leaving the scene of an accident \u2014 might push your premium up by hundreds of dollars every six months. So, while a ticket might seem like a one-time issue, it can end up costing you well beyond that initial fine.<\/p><h3>Comparing Florida to States Like North Carolina<\/h3><p>While Florida\u2019s point system is strict, other states take it even further. North Carolina, for example, is notorious for its rigorous points system and the steep insurance rate increases that accompany violations. In North Carolina, a driver caught speeding 15 mph over the limit in a 55-mph zone gets a whopping <strong>four points on their license<\/strong> and could face <strong>up to 80% increases<\/strong> in their insurance premiums. That\u2019s in stark contrast to Florida, where the points system is somewhat more lenient with certain speeding violations, but it still isn\u2019t exactly forgiving.<\/p><p>North Carolina also places more emphasis on reducing driving infractions in general. After a certain number of points, North Carolina drivers must complete defensive driving courses or lose their license for extended periods. In comparison, Florida offers options like \u201cdriving school\u201d to offset points for certain infractions, making it easier to avoid long-term damage to your driving record. Florida is a member of this agreement, which is an arrangement between states to share traffic violation information. So if you, as a Florida driver, receive a ticket in another state, that violation doesn\u2019t stay hidden; it often makes its way back to Florida. Depending on the severity of the offense, points could be added to your Florida license just as if you had committed the infraction within state lines.<\/p><p>When an out-of-state violation is reported to Florida, the state evaluates the nature of the infraction. Florida does not apply points for every type of ticket received elsewhere \u2014 for example, parking violations or non-moving violations generally won\u2019t affect your Florida record. But for significant moving violations, like speeding, reckless driving, or DUIs, points will usually be added according to Florida\u2019s point system guidelines, regardless of where the incident happened. This means a speeding ticket issued in, say, Georgia or New York for 15 mph over the limit can translate into four points on your Florida license. More serious violations that would result in an automatic suspension within Florida can also lead to a suspension, even if they occurred out of state.<\/p><p>In some cases, drivers are surprised to see points added to their record long after the incident, especially if there\u2019s a delay in communication between states.
